Russia - Manufacturing Contribution to Gross Value Added Growth
Since 2014, Russia Manufacturing Contribution to Gross Value Added Growth grew 14.3points year on year. At 0.19 Percent in 2019, the country was ranked number 22 comparing other countries in Manufacturing Contribution to Gross Value Added Growth. Russia is overtaken by Colombia, which was number 21 at 0.22 Percent and is followed by Norway with 0.18 Percent. Slovenia lead the ranking with 1.75 Percent in 2019, that is a growth of 165.1points versus 2018. India, Ireland and Poland resp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Denmark witnessed the best average annual growth at +36.8points per year, while Estonia witnessed the worst performance at -19.9points per year.
